About
Dr. Hadi Khani is a leading researcher at the intersection of energy systems and robotics, whose work is pioneering the development of self-powered, untethered machines. His primary research areas include energy harvesting and storage technologies, power electronics, and the integration of these systems into autonomous robots. Dr. Khani’s major contribution is his visionary framework for next-generation energy solutions that enable robots to operate freely in harsh, confined, or remote environments without the constraints of batteries or tethers. His highly cited 2022 paper, “Next‐Generation Energy Harvesting and Storage Technologies for Robots Across All Scales” (62 citations), synthesizes this approach, outlining how diverse energy sources can be seamlessly integrated into robotic platforms of all sizes. This work has become a foundational reference for researchers seeking to break the power bottleneck in field robotics.
